I would recommend you to read this article as well as SQL Server Interview questions and answers to learn more about SQL interview questions. In this article also, I tried to answer each question in a very precise manner. Accelerate backup speed, reduce storage https://remotemode.net/ costs and use the cloud for disaster recovery. At Intellipaat, you can enroll in either the instructor-led online training or self-paced training. Apart from this, Intellipaat also offers corporate training for organizations to upskill their workforce.
- This training course will provide you with a complete set of skills to help you land a high-paying job in any of the best companies around the world.
- The database administrator is expected to stay abreast of emerging technologies and new design approaches.
- In this article we cover some areas that can help you get a
better understanding of what a DBA does, what skills are needed, career path
options and we’ll
also cover some salary information.
- This program helped me gain the right skills to make a career switch from a consultant to a senior software engineer.
- Such scripts are stored as a .sql file, and are used either for management of databases or to create the database schema during the deployment of a database.
And you must have integrity and be an
honest person – qualities required for guarding and securing sensitive
data. This SQL Server administration tutorial provides you with the knowledge and skills you need to administer SQL Server database servers effectively. SQL Server’s journey began on June 12th, 1988, when Microsoft joined Ashton-Tate and Sybase to develop a new variant of Sybase SQL Server for IBM OS/2.
How do I find hidden files taking up space?
In addition, DBAs work with application developers to ensure accurate and efficient application design for database access. At times, DBAs may be asked to modify or write application code to help development projects. System administrators are responsible for the DBMS installation, configuration and setup but typically have no responsibility for database design and support.
- The first version served as Microsoft’s entry to the enterprise-level database market, competing with the MySQL, Sybase, IBM, and Oracle databases.
- DBCC CHECKDB heavily uses a tempdb database to temporarily store data and perform activities
that are needed for integrity check like reading each data page and ensuring there is no corruption.
- Ivica boasts over 12 years of working experience including extensive work as a Senior Developer.
- Top companies and start-ups choose Toptal SQL Server freelancers for their mission-critical software projects.
Microsoft SQL Server is a feature rich database management system product. Database administrators cannot keep up with the enormous amount of T-SQL commands and their syntax to get information from SQL Server. Each and every feature supported by SQL Server has its own list of commands and one article cannot cover all of them. Warner is a SQL Server Certified Master, MVP, and Solutions Architect at Pythian, a global Canada-based company specializing in data and infrastructure services. A brief stint in .NET programming led to his early DBA formation, working for enterprise customers in Hewlett-Packard’s ITO organization. From HP he transitioned to his current position at Pythian, managing multiple clients of different sizes and industries.
Your 10 day Standard free trial includes
There are ongoing debates about whether certifications give you an advantage
in your job search. Most employees don’t have the certification as a requirement
for the Database Administrator’s role. Depending on the Team you work with or company, the skills requirements may vary.
It will also depend on your experience level (Junior, Intermediate, or Senior DBA). Another benefit of being a Database Administrator is that you can transition quite
easily to other Database roles if you want to. Find more information about
here. The Database Administrator job is ranked as
#7 in Best Technology Jobs (according to USnews.com, 2021).
Advantages of SQL Server Instances
Beyond general-purpose, the primary roles include system DBA, database architect, database analyst, application DBA, task-oriented DBA, performance analyst, data warehouse administrator and cloud DBA. The DBA also must establish policies and procedures pertaining to the management, security, maintenance and use of the database management system. The DBA group creates training materials and instructs employees in the proper usage and access of the DBMS. A database administrator (DBA) is the information technician responsible for directing and performing all activities related to maintaining a successful database environment. A DBA makes sure an organization’s databases and related applications operate functionally and efficiently.
We record each training session and upload it after the session to our LMS which can be accessible to the students. Read
this tip that has a
DBA Checklist with daily, monthly, and other tasks. Depending on the organization where you work, the Database Administrators
work as a member of the
IT Operations Team, the Application Support Team or part of the
Software Development Team working with Programmers \ Developers. Regardless of the team, DBAs usually interact with all
other IT teams and often with the business as well.
Typically, a DBA has a bachelor’s degree in computer science or information science from an accredited university or college, as well as some on-the-job training with a specific database product. In some cases, DBAs may not be required to have a bachelor’s degree if they have extensive information technology work experience. The primary function of a DBA is to implement, maintain, optimize and manage database structures for the enterprise.
- Observe users, groups, permissions, and configurations to improve compliance to GDPR, HIPAA, SOX, FISMA, and PCI.
- Ideally, s/he will have an appreciation of – and long-term perspective on – how best to leverage database technology to address the business opportunities and challenges facing the company.
- SQL Server these days is a complex software that goes beyond Database Administration.
According to the client-server model, a database server is a computer program that provides several services for our database to other programs or computers. As a result, we referred to a SQL Server as a database server that uses SQL as its query language. The relational database management system (RDBMS) is a Microsoft https://remotemode.net/become-a-sql-dba-developer/ software product mainly used to store and retrieve data for the same or other applications. We can run these applications on the same computer or a different one. Many different types of DBAs exist, the most common type being the general-purpose DBA, who performs all types of administrative and data-related work.
The Fundamental Guide to SQL Query Optimization
Nicolas has over eight years of experience in Microsoft technologies and open-source solutions (such as LAMP stack, WordPress, OpenCart, and Moodle). He enjoys learning new technologies and has developed his software skills primarily by doing research on his own. As a systems engineer, he has vast knowledge of many technologies, such as PHP, HTML+CSS, JS, and jQuery. DBAs make sure that data is secure, is available, and that even large databases perform
well. Without a DBA, a company may not be able to resolve critical database issues
on time or may not be able to solve them fully (if database backups are missing
or unusable). Just like most things that require professional service, databases
also need someone who has adequate knowledge and skills.
Successful completion of this Azure SQL DBA (Azure SQL Database is the cloud version of SQL Server) or SQL Server DBA online training helps you prepare for Microsoft DP Certification Exam. Learners can continue to be plugged into MindMajix through the included job-search assistance and Mock Interviews, making you the best fit for SQL Server Database Administration jobs. Automatic seeding is a feature launched in SQL Server 2016 to initialize the secondary replica. Earlier we have only one option to initialize secondary replica that is using backup, copy and restore database
operation. We use this feature while creating the always on availability group. Navisite’s elite SQL Server solutions are architected to provide a superior level of SQL Server database support.